A push poll is designed to sound like a voter survey but is actually used to spread false or misleading information about an opponent.
Rationales
The reasons or explanations behind decisions, actions, or beliefs, providing logical bases for justifying certain courses of action.
Incarceration
The act of confining an individual, typically as a legal punishment for a crime.
Recidivism
The tendency of a convicted criminal to reoffend, often used as a measure of the effectiveness of criminal justice systems and rehabilitation programs.
Strain Theories
Theories in sociology that relate the origins of deviant behavior and crime to the pressures and stresses felt by individuals to achieve societal goals when they lack the means to do so legally.
